Kurze Frage zum Keymapping

  • Hallo,

    wenn ich die Funktionen meiner Fernbedienung ändern will, muss ich dann die keyboard.xml bearbeiten oder die remote.xml? Und kann ich die remote.xml dann auch aus dem Installationsverzeichnis

    nach %APPDATA%\XBMC\userdata\keymaps\ kopieren?


    Gruß
    Der Guru

  • Für Fernbedienungen ist die remote.xml zuständig.

    Die Dateien kannst du auch direkt in dem Installationsverzeichnis verändern, oder auch in den userdata Ordner legen.
    Ursprünglich war es wohl so gedacht, die Datei im Original unverändert zu lassen, im userdata-Ordner eine neue Datei anzulegen und dort nur die Ergänzungen bzw. Änderungen einzutragen.

    Ich persönlich finds nur unnötig die selbe Datei 2x im System zu haben und bearbeite bei mir die Dateien immer direkt im Original.

    Nur das Backup nicht vergessen! ;)

  • Für Fernbedienungen ist die remote.xml zuständig.


    Das stimmt so nicht ganz. Es kommt darauf an was für Befehle die FB sendet. Meine Harmony sendet z.B. Tastaturbefehle und daher muss man die keyboard.xml anpassen und nicht die remote.xml.
    Das kannst du aber ganz einfach testen, indem du z.B. die Tasten für Hoch, runter oder links, rechts vertauschst und dann schaust ob es funktioniert hat.

    Amazon Fire TV 4k | KODI 17.X
    HTPC: ASUS F2A85-M LE | A6-5400K | 4GB DDR3-1866 | 128GB SSD | Windows 10 64 bit | KODI 17.X
    AVR: Onkyo TX-NR509 5.1 + Teufel Consono 35
    TV: Samsung UE55ES6300 55"
    FB: Harmony 785

    Wo finde ich das xbmc.log File?

    Wer einen Rechtschreibfehler findet darf ihn behalten !

  • Also ich weiß jetzt wenigstens schonmal, das ich die keyboard.xml bearbeiten muss, und ein paar Sachen hab ich auch schon hingekriegt. Allerdings schaffe ich es nicht, eine Taste auf der Fernbedienung so zu belegen, das ich damit das Kontextmenü öffnen kann. Hätte den Befehl gern auf der gelben Taste (die scheint standardmäßig nicht belegt zu sein) oderauf der Record-Taste, die ich sonst auch für nichts weiter brauche.
    Habe im global-Bereich der xml-Datei folgende Einträge probiert:

    <yellow>ContextMenu</yellow> funktionierte nicht
    <record>ContextMenu</record> funktionierte auch nicht

    Die beiden Tastenbezeichnungen yellow und record stammen aber aus der remote.xml, deshalb hab ich auch noch folgendes im Bereich global probiert:

    <remote>
    <yellow>ContextMenu</yellow>
    </remote>

    Dasselbe habe ich auch mit record probiert, hat natürlich beides nicht geklappt.

    Habt ihr ne Idee, wie ich das hinkriege?

  • Was hast du denn für eine fernbedienung?

    HTPC:
    Gehäuse: SilverStone Milo ML03, CPU:AMD A6-5400K, Mainboard:ASRock FM2A75 Pro4-M, Ram: Kingston HyperX DIMM XMP Kit 4GB, Netzteil:be quiet! Pure Power L7 300W ATX 2.3, Festplatten: SanDisk SSD 128GB und Seagate 2TB, Laufwerk: BD

  • Und wie finde ich das heraus?


    Unter Windows geht das am einfachsten mit dem Tool Showkey.exe, siehe http://sourceforge.net/projects/xbmcm…ey.exe/download

    Amazon Fire TV 4k | KODI 17.X
    HTPC: ASUS F2A85-M LE | A6-5400K | 4GB DDR3-1866 | 128GB SSD | Windows 10 64 bit | KODI 17.X
    AVR: Onkyo TX-NR509 5.1 + Teufel Consono 35
    TV: Samsung UE55ES6300 55"
    FB: Harmony 785

    Wo finde ich das xbmc.log File?

    Wer einen Rechtschreibfehler findet darf ihn behalten !

  • Versuch doch mal die 'C' Taste. Habe dies in meiner Harmonykonfiguration eingestellt.

    Standardtasten

    Taste: Deine Wunschtaste z.B. Gelb
    Gerät: MCE Keyboard
    Befehl: C

    Gruß,
    JakeB

    Testumgebung - OS: Ubuntu 20.04 LTS | Kodi 19.1 | skin: Rapier 12.2.26 + Transparency! (views Slide und Fanart) | für Datenbank-/ Skin Tests
    Live Umgebung - OS: Ubuntu 16.04.3 LTS | Kodi 17.6 | skin: Transparency! 10.3.0 | TV

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!